Here is the latest from camaro6: With GM switching over to the new GEN-V engine architecture throughout their product line (including Corvette and full-size trucks), it wouldn’t make sense for Chevrolet to unleash a brand new Camaro out into the wild with an 8-year old LS3. From the looks of things, the last LS-powered vehicle sold from GM North America will be the 2017 SS sedan. You can expect, however, a current model SS equivalent with a 450-460 hp LT1, and independent rear suspension to return across the range. We wouldn’t expect a 1LE, ZL1 or a Z/28 replacement until later into the production cycle, but with rumors of convertibles already running around, don’t be too shocked if it happens for 2016. Underneath, as we have already anticipated in previous articles form GM EFI, is the Alpha architecture that’s also shared with the ATS and CTS. This should provide Camaro owners with a lighter and more nimble vehicle.
